
On December 1, 1989 the world was introduced to the third and most lasting classic of the National Lampoon's Christmas Vacation installments as Clark Griswold's dream of having a fantastic family Christmas with his family descends into a hilarious nightmare. This book, releasing on the 35th Anniversary of the film's release, is a celebration, and a detailed examination of many trivial and behind-the-scenes details related to this movie, which originated from a John Hughes short story called "Christmas '59" which was originally published in the December 1980 issue of National Lampoon magazine.
